OEM Exhaust Mod - Rattle at startup

So I have a modified OEM muffler (ACM mod) paired with test pipes. Alpine Stage 2 tune, cold start still active. As of recent, I've had an obnoxious rattle coming from the rear of the car that my shop and I have identified as likely coming from within the muffler/rear section itself. It lasts about 10 seconds when the car is initially started, and goes away after that. Sometimes comes back at low RPM in 1st gear. It literally sounds like 2 pieces of metal violently banging together (I'll get a video when the car is back from the shop).

This is my second e9x with the same exhaust setup. 7 years total between the two cars and I have never experienced or heard of others having this issue.

Has anyone else experienced this?

I am looking at my options and right now it seems like I'll have to find a new muffler/box. I would think opening up the muffler, attempting to find & fix the issue (which is still unknown) may be going down a rabbit hole.

Cracked weld, harmonics on cold start causing the rattle.

I have a Corsa with which the two prongs (point at one another) that slide into the hangers at the very rear of the muffler would rattle against one another on cold start.

More likely that they rattle against one another on the Corsa because the cans are independent and so can move towards each other but throwing it out there just in case.
